Abstract

PURPOSE:To enhance the S/N ratio, to simplify an apparatus and to facilitate operation, by connecting a plurality of superconducting quantum interference devices (SQUID) in series, in parallel or in a combination of both of them. CONSTITUTION:A plurality of SQUIDs 3 are used as signal detecting elements, and the number of them and the arrangement thereof are selected so that the impedance of the whole of them becomes as follows to arrange them in series, in parallel or in a combination of both of them. That is, when the output impedance of the aggregate 6 of SQUIDs is selected and the SQUID aggregate 6 can be directly connected to an amplifier 5, selection is performed so as to minimize the noise index of the amplifier 5 and, when the SQUID aggregate 6 is connected to the amplifier 5 by a cable, selection is performed so as to take SQUID collation. Since the output impedance of the whole becomes a value optimum to the amplifier 5 of the next stage, the SQUID aggregate 6 itself is also used as an impedance transformer circuit. By this constitution, an S/N ratio is enhanced and an apparatus can be simplified and operation can be facilitated.
